About Tha Muang Time Zone

Tha Muang, Thailand uses the Asia/Bangkok IANA time zone, which is the standard time zone for most of Thailand. The local offset is UTC+7 all year, so the clock stays consistent through every month and does not shift for daylight saving time. That makes scheduling simpler for businesses that work with Thai suppliers, logistics operators, and regional offices in nearby countries.

Tha Muang does not observe daylight saving time, so there are no seasonal clock changes to manage. Tha Muang City Details

Tha Muang, Thailand has a population of 26,746, which makes it a smaller urban center with local commercial and administrative activity rather than a major metropolitan hub. Its coordinates are 13.96118° N, 99.64122° E, placing it in central-western Thailand within reach of Bangkok-linked road and logistics corridors. The local currency is THB, and Thailand’s country dialing code is +66, which is important for arranging hotel bookings, supplier calls, and travel confirmations.

Time Differences from Tha Muang

Tha Muang, Thailand is a fixed UTC+7 location, so its relationship with other cities is easy to map for day-to-day planning. For teams in Asia, that often means convenient overlap with Tokyo and Dubai, while Europe and North America usually require early-morning or late-evening coordination.

  • New York: In January, Tha Muang (UTC+7) is 12 hours ahead of New York (UTC-5): when it is 9:00 AM in Tha Muang, it is 9:00 PM the previous day in New York. In July, Tha Muang (UTC+7) is 11 hours ahead of New York (UTC-4): when it is 9:00 AM in Tha Muang, it is 10:00 PM the previous day in New York. This is a major consideration for US sales calls, customer support handoffs, and product meetings.

  • London: In January, Tha Muang (UTC+7) is 7 hours ahead of London (UTC+0): when it is 9:00 AM in Tha Muang, it is 2:00 AM in London. In July, Tha Muang (UTC+7) is 6 hours ahead of London (UTC+1): when it is 9:00 AM in Tha Muang, it is 3:00 AM in London. That means a Thai morning meeting is usually too early for UK participants unless they join from a night shift or an on-call rotation.

  • Tokyo: In January, Tha Muang (UTC+7) is 2 hours behind Tokyo (UTC+9): when it is 9:00 AM in Tha Muang, it is 11:00 AM in Tokyo. In July, Tha Muang (UTC+7) is 2 hours behind Tokyo (UTC+9): when it is 9:00 AM in Tha Muang, it is 11:00 AM in Tokyo. This is a convenient overlap for regional business, especially for tech, manufacturing, and supply-chain coordination across Southeast Asia and Japan.

  • Sydney: In January, Tha Muang (UTC+7) is 4 hours behind Sydney (UTC+11): when it is 9:00 AM in Tha Muang, it is 1:00 PM in Sydney. In July, Tha Muang (UTC+7) is 3 hours behind Sydney (UTC+10): when it is 9:00 AM in Tha Muang, it is 12:00 PM in Sydney. That makes Thai late morning a workable window for Australia-based teams, especially for project check-ins and operations calls.

  • Dubai: In January, Tha Muang (UTC+7) is 3 hours ahead of Dubai (UTC+4): when it is 9:00 AM in Tha Muang, it is 6:00 AM in Dubai. In July, Tha Muang (UTC+7) is 3 hours ahead of Dubai (UTC+4): when it is 9:00 AM in Tha Muang, it is 6:00 AM in Dubai.
